**Vendor note: Inkmill markdown pipeline**

Rendering for Parchway docs is outsourced to Inkmill under an annual contract, renewing each March. They handle sanitization and PDF export; we own the upload queue. SLA: 4-hour response on rendering failures. Escalate only after two failed retries. Their support desk is reachable at the address below.

billing contact of hahaf-baguf = zorael.tammir.jorius@sivrelhq.internal

Capacity note for new folks on the Rookmere platform team. The flaky DNS resolution in the batch tier traces to resolver cache churn under burst load, not upstream outages. We overprovision resolver pods by 2x during nightly jobs and pin negative-cache TTLs low. Do not copy prod settings into staging blindly. The resolver tuning constants we currently run with are listed below.

constants for kageg-bawif:
QUOTAS = {
    "quenwyn": 1,
    "oliix": 10,
}

Dear contractor, welcome to the Osterfield Media Wing. Your recording session for the training-video series takes place in Studio 2, ground floor, past the glass atrium. Please arrive fifteen minutes early so reception can issue a day pass and walk you through the fire-exit routes. Food and drink are not permitted near the mixing desk, and all cabling must be taped down before filming. The studio door locks automatically; to re-enter during your session, use the keypad code printed below.

door code, tahop-fahap: bdg-JZCXMY-37375484

INTERNAL MEMO — Legacy Pricing, Bravent Software

To the incoming director: legacy customers on the Ayrton tier have not seen an increase since launch. Proposal: 9% uplift effective next renewal cycle, with a 60-day notice window. Churn modelling from the Dunmere office suggests sub-2% attrition. Support and sales scripts are drafted. Approval is needed before notices go out on the first of the month. The underlying commercial reasoning is appended below.

internal memo for kaduf-baduf: Only 35 of the 378 pilot accounts renewed Holir, so a churn review is set for June 11. Eliielax Group is in early talks to buy Silaelix Group for about $142.1 million.